## Webhook Retry Semantics — Pulseforge Dispatcher

When a webhook delivery to a subscriber endpoint fails with a 5xx or times out after 10 seconds, Pulseforge retries with exponential backoff: 30s, 2m, 10m, 1h, then 6h, for a maximum of five attempts. A 4xx response is treated as permanent and is never retried, so be careful when debugging subscriber errors. Attempts are idempotent via the delivery ID header. Before escalating a stuck delivery, capture the token printed at the top of the dispatcher log.

session token of tajef-bageg = htk21_5d90d574934f3ccae6437

## Local Setup

Wirepipe gateway supports permessage-deflate; it cuts bandwidth ~60% but costs CPU and adds latency under burst. Default is off locally. Toggle with `WS_COMPRESS=1` and compare the benchmark suite output before changing defaults. Metrics from each run are written to the benchmarks database using the connection string below.

replica DSN, kajep-yahag: mssql://praok_svc:iF@db-8d68.plorvaio.local:5432/eliion

Plugin authors have reported that long-running batch resize jobs using the Pixelforge CLI drop their metadata-store connection roughly every forty minutes. The failure surfaces as a timeout during manifest writes, after which the resizer retries indefinitely without backoff. We suspect the pooler is recycling idle sessions more aggressively than our plugin SDK expects. To reproduce against the staging metadata store, configure your plugin harness with the connection string below.

primary connection of yagep-kahip = redis://giliel_svc:zYiKsLL2PLpfPL@db-348f.xolmarsys.corp:5432/fenwyn

The Lanternwick config service now supports hot-reloading: the watcher polls the manifest, diffs against the in-memory snapshot, and applies changes without restarting workers. Reload failures fall back to the last known-good snapshot and emit a warning metric. Reviewers should focus on the debounce logic in `reload_loop.py`, since rapid successive writes previously caused thrashing. The tuning constants governing poll cadence and debounce windows are listed below.

tuning constants:
QUOTAS = {
    "druwyn": 5,
    "holix": 5,
    "zorath": 5,
    "holwyn": 10,
}